My first question is can I swap in the stock cap. I do not trust these tank manufacturers to make the pressure release cap properly. There is no telling if the thread is the same as the plastic OE until you receive it and try. All too often the quality control is lacking and the thread can be poorly cut - and the stock cap can pop off under pressure. My strategy is buy the cheapest one on ebay as many look identical from the same slum factory in China/Vietnam/Laos/Washington DC countryside. The cheapest ones are $52 shipped.
